    Abstract: We describe an active node, which receives an active message containing an active application identifier, transmits the active application identifier to an active applications server. receives associated code from the active applications server, and executes the associated code. The active node also may transmit to the active applications server information relating to its own environment, and information relating to whether it is an edge node or core node in the network, enabling the active applications server to determine the associated code to return to the active node.

    Abstract: A routing information management device for a router of a communication network comprises a first routing information base fed with routing information contained in routing protocol messages, a second forwarding information base having a maximum number of entries, and management means that compare at selected times the number of entries in the first routing information base relating to sending to a selected threshold less than or equal to the maximum number of entries in the second forwarding information base so as to feed the second forwarding information base with routing information selected as a function of the result of the comparison.

    Abstract: A distributed, multistage agent for monitoring, diagnosis and maintenance of network devices comprises an input/output interface for receiving input monitoring and diagnostic data relevant to operation of a first neighboring agent and transmitting output monitoring and diagnostic data relevant to operation of the host network device to a second neighboring agent. An agent process analyzes the input data and generates processed data characterizing operation of the host network device, using a local database which stores expected performance data on operation of said network device. The processed data is correlated with the expected data any error is signaled to the network operator. The agents may be designed as a multiple stage process, the stages being triggered by the data output by an earlier stage only when needed.

    Abstract: A method of tracing a route between an origin node and a target node within a TCP/IP data network, consisting of sending in a dichotomy-based fashion a succession of messages for tracing the route. The advantage of this method is that it reduces the number of messages necessary for tracing the route.

    Abstract: A system is dedicated to controlling interruption of the operation of a router of an Internet protocol communication network. The system comprises observation means which, in the event of reception of an instruction to observe IP datagrams in transit received by the router, deliver an alert signal in case of absence of detection of IP datagrams during a first selected time period. It further comprises control means which, if it is required to interrupt the operation of the router, instruct processing means to generate outgoing warning messages to other routers reporting the withdrawal of routes for routing of IP datagrams by the router, instruct the observation means to commence an observation, and authorize interruption of the operation of the router in the event of reception of an alert signal from the observation means.
